An objective approach using three indexes for determining fatal hypothermia due to cold exposure; statistical analysis of oxyhemoglobin saturation data

摘要

Analysis of oxyhemoglobin (O-2-Hb) saturation levels in the left and right heart blood is useful in the assessment of exposure to cold surroundings before death. We quantified conventional subjective visual evaluation of O-2-Hb saturation levels and developed useful diagnostic criteria for fatal hypothermia: O(2)Hb saturation in the left heart blood (L-O(2)Hb) was >= 36%, the O-2-Hb saturation gap between the left and right heart blood (L-R gap) was >13%, and the 02-Hb saturation ratio of the left to right heart blood (L/R ratio) was >1.8. When we used L-O(2)Hb of >36% as a basic criterion and applied a further criterion of an L R gap of >13% or an L/R ratio of >1.8, these criteria registered a sensitivity level of >86% and specificity level of >93% for the diagnosis of fatal hypothermia. This method can be useful for determining fatal hypothermia in connection with conventional autopsy findings, as well as histological and biochemical markers. (C) 2015 Elsevier Ireland Ltd. 机译:分析左右心脏血液中的氧合血红蛋白(O-2-Hb)饱和度水平有助于评估死亡前暴露于寒冷环境中的情况。我们量化了O-2-Hb饱和度水平的常规主观视觉评估,并为致命的体温过低制定了有用的诊断标准:左心脏血液中的O(2)Hb饱和度(LO(2)Hb)> = 36%,O-左右心脏血液之间的2-Hb饱和间隙(LR间隙)> 13%,左右心脏血液的02-Hb饱和比(L / R比)> 1.8。当我们使用> 36%的LO(2)Hb作为基本标准并应用LR间隙> 13%或L / R比> 1.8的进一步标准时,这些标准的敏感度水平> 86%,而诊断致命性体温过低的特异性水平> 93%。该方法可用于确定与常规尸检结果以及组织学和生化标志物相关的致命性体温过低。 (C)2015 Elsevier Ireland Ltd.保留所有权利。
